"What advice would I give a new photographer just starting out?"Learn your craft and learn every aspect of your craft, then keep learning how to do it better.
  1. Light – Understanding light is the first basic principle every photographer should know inside out and in every form. The ability to see light and how to use it is still the most powerful thing a photographer can know above all else. It will distinguish you from every other person who holds a camera.
  2. Control – Learning how to control things in photography comes in different forms. The first thing on the list is making sure you how to control any situation you are thrown into. 
  3. Market – Know and understand your primary market, remember that you won't want to and can't photograph everything."
